package org.openhab.binding.neohub.internal;

import java.util.Dictionary;

import org.apache.commons.lang.StringUtils;
import org.openhab.binding.neohub.NeoHubBindingProvider;
import org.openhab.binding.neohub.internal.InfoResponse.Device;
import org.openhab.core.binding.AbstractActiveBinding;
import org.openhab.core.library.types.DecimalType;
import org.openhab.core.library.types.OnOffType;
import org.openhab.core.library.types.StringType;
import org.openhab.core.types.Command;
import org.openhab.core.types.State;
import org.osgi.service.cm.ConfigurationException;
import org.osgi.service.cm.ManagedService;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;

/**
* Actively polls neohub for status of all devices.
*
* @author Sebastian Prehn
* @since 1.5.0
*/
public class NeoHubBinding extends AbstractActiveBinding<NeoHubBindingProvider>
    implements ManagedService {

  private static final Logger logger = LoggerFactory
      .getLogger(NeoHubBinding.class);

  /**
   * The refresh interval which is used to poll values from the neohub server
   * (optional, defaults to 60000ms).
   */
  private long refreshInterval = 60000;

  /**
   * Hostname or IP address of neohub on tcp network.
   */
  private String hostname;

  /**
   * Port of neohub on tcp network. (optional, defaults to 4242).
   */
  private int port = 4242;

  public NeoHubBinding() {
  }

  public void activate() {
  }

  public void deactivate() {
  }

  /**
   * {@inheritDoc}
   */
  @Override
  protected long getRefreshInterval() {
    return refreshInterval;
  }

  /**
   * {@inheritDoc}
   */
  @Override
  protected String getName() {
    return "neohub Refresh Service";
  }

  /**
   * {@inheritDoc}
   */
  @Override
  protected void execute() {
    try {
      // send info request
      final InfoResponse response = createProtocol().info();
      for (NeoHubBindingProvider provider : providers) {
        for (String itemName : provider.getItemNames()) {
          final String device = provider.getNeoStatDevice(itemName);
          final NeoStatProperty property = provider
              .getNeoStatProperty(itemName);
          final State result = mapResponseToState(response, device,
              property);

          if (eventPublisher != null) {
            eventPublisher.postUpdate(itemName, result);
          }
        }
      }

    } catch (final RuntimeException e) {
      logger.warn("Failed to fetch info from neo hub.", e);
    }

  }

  private State mapResponseToState(final InfoResponse infoResponse,
      final String deviceName, final NeoStatProperty property) {
    final Device deviceInfo = infoResponse.getDevice(deviceName);
    switch (property) {
    case CurrentTemperature:
      return new DecimalType(deviceInfo.getCurrentTemperature());
    case CurrentFloorTemperature:
      return new DecimalType(deviceInfo.getCurrentFloorTemperature());
    case CurrentSetTemperature:
      return new DecimalType(deviceInfo.getCurrentSetTemperature());
    case DeviceName:
      return new StringType(deviceInfo.getDeviceName());
    case Away:
      return deviceInfo.isAway() ? OnOffType.ON : OnOffType.OFF;
    case Standby:
      return deviceInfo.isStandby() ? OnOffType.ON : OnOffType.OFF;
    case Heating:
      return deviceInfo.isHeating() ? OnOffType.ON : OnOffType.OFF;
    default:
      throw new IllegalStateException(
          String.format(
              "No result mapping configured for this neo stat property: %s",
              property));
    }
  }

  /**
   * {@inheritDoc}
   */
  @Override
  protected void internalReceiveCommand(String itemName, Command command) {
    for (NeoHubBindingProvider provider : providers) {
      if (!provider.providesBindingFor(itemName)) {
        continue;
      }

      final String device = provider.getNeoStatDevice(itemName);
      switch (provider.getNeoStatProperty(itemName)) {
      case Away:
        if (command instanceof OnOffType) {
          OnOffType onOffType = (OnOffType) command;
          createProtocol().setAway(OnOffType.ON == onOffType, device);
        }
        break;
      case Standby:
        if (command instanceof OnOffType) {
          OnOffType onOffType = (OnOffType) command;
          createProtocol().setStandby(OnOffType.ON == onOffType,
              device);
        }
      default:
        break;
      }
    }

  }

  private NeoHubProtocol createProtocol() {
    return new NeoHubProtocol(new NeoHubConnector(hostname, port));
  }

  /**
   * {@inheritDoc}
   */
  @Override
  public void updated(final Dictionary<String, ?> config)
      throws ConfigurationException {
    if (config != null) {
      final String refreshIntervalString = (String) config.get("refresh");
      if (StringUtils.isNotBlank(refreshIntervalString)) {
        try {
          refreshInterval = Long.parseLong(refreshIntervalString);
        } catch (NumberFormatException e) {
          throw new ConfigurationException(
              "refresh",
              String.format(
                  "Provided value (%s) cannot be parsed to an long integer.",
                  port));
        }
      }

      final String host = (String) config.get("hostname");
      if (StringUtils.isNotBlank(host)) {
        this.hostname = host;
      } else {
        throw new ConfigurationException("hostname",
            "Required configuration parameter is not set.");
      }

      final String port = (String) config.get("port");
      if (StringUtils.isNotBlank(port)) {
        try {
          this.port = Integer.parseInt(port);
        } catch (NumberFormatException e) {
          throw new ConfigurationException(
              "port",
              String.format(
                  "Provided value (%s) cannot be parsed to an integer.",
                  port));
        }
      }

      setProperlyConfigured(true);
    }
  }

}
